Businesses need to grow their revenue to stay afloat and prosper. Because of this, it’s essential to ensure that your revenue growth is steady and consistent. You want to avoid sudden revenue drops, which can risk your business.

You can do a few key things to help ensure your business revenue continues to grow. Here are some tips.

1. Innovate

The best way to guarantee revenue growth is to innovate. Come up with new products or services that solve problems for your customers. This will not only help you attract new customers but also keep your existing customers coming back for more.

Some companies are afraid to innovate because they don’t want to rock the boat. But if you’re not innovating, you’re not growing. And if you’re not growing, your revenue will eventually stagnate. Look for ways to improve your products and services and make them more appealing to your customers.

For example, Apple is constantly innovating. Each new iPhone that comes out is better than the last. This keeps customers interested and excited about the products and keeps them coming back for more.

2. Diversify your income streams

Don’t rely on just one income stream. If you do, you’re putting all your eggs in one basket. This is a risky strategy because if that one income stream dries up, your business will suffer. Multiple income streams are essential so that if one fails, you have others to fall back on.

One of the best ways to diversify your income is to create multiple products or services. This way, if one product doesn’t sell well, you have others that might. You can also try selling your products or services in different markets. Some markets may be more challenging than others, but it’s essential to reach as many people as possible.

Another way to diversify your income is to invest in other businesses. This can help you mitigate risk and give you a steadier income stream. 3. Focus on your customers

Your customers are the lifeblood of your business. Without them, you wouldn’t have a business. That’s why it’s so important to focus on them and give them what they want. The best way to do this is to listen to their feedback.

Make it a point to collect feedback from your customers regularly. You can do this through surveys, interviews, focus groups, or casual conversations. Find out what they like and don’t like about your products or services. Find out what their needs are and how you can better meet them. Once you have this feedback, use it to improve your products or services for their satisfaction.

It would be best if you also worked to expand your customer base. You can do this by marketing to new groups of people or by selling your products or services in new markets. The more customers you have, the more revenue you’ll generate.

4. Reinvest in your business

If you want your business to grow, you need to reinvest in it. This means using some of your profits to improve your products, services, or infrastructure. Reinvesting profits in your business will help it grow and become more profitable.

It can be challenging to part with your profits, but it’s important to remember that reinvesting in your business is an investment in its future. The more you reinvest, the more likely your business will be successful in the long run.

A good rule of thumb is reinvesting 10% of your profits into your business. This will help you ensure that your business continues to grow and thrive. If you’re unsure how to reinvest your earnings, talk to a business consultant or accountant. They can help you find the best way to use your money to improve your business.

5. Keep your expenses low

To ensure revenue growth, you want to keep your expenses low. This way, you’ll have more money to reinvest in your business and more money to put towards marketing and other growth initiatives.

Almost every business spends thousands on unnecessary things. It’s crucial to analyze your expenses and see where you can cut back. You can also save money by bargaining with vendors and suppliers. If you’re paying too much for something, try negotiating a better price. Most businesses are open to negotiation, so it’s worth a try.
